Streaming as the Ultimate Language Tutor
Breaking down the mechanics, this strategy utilizes the interactive streaming feature, which enhances your viewing experience with simultaneous translations in both the target and mother tongue languages. This smart feature enables learners analyze and contrast instant meaning displays and linguistic structures, aiding understanding and retention without interrupting the pivotal moments of your most-loved shows.
This technique relies on real-world linguistic application, where vocabulary and phrases are absorbed in the practical and cultural contexts they are used within the shows. For example, experiencing colloquial expressions during a dramatic confrontation in a mystery series or listening to authentic dialogues in a romantic scene ensures fluency training is relatable and easy to recall. Thus, language enthusiasts don’t just learn vocabulary; they absorb regional traditions, comedic timing, idiomatic expressions, and speech patterns authentically spoken by fluent voices.
A Learning Experience for Everyone
Whether you’re a beginner or improving your proficiency, using Netflix as a language tool adapts to all skill levels. Entry-level speakers can gradually build up their vocabulary and auditory comprehension, while advanced learners refine their comprehension and speech accuracy. The interactive capabilities like stopping on tricky sentences or replaying clips deepen understanding, suiting different learning styles without the strictness found in structured courses.
Imagine analyzing the high-speed conversations in *Lupin*, or understanding complex Spanish idioms in *Money Heist*. With every segment, viewers not only enjoy engrossing story arcs but also engage in effortless language practice that feels more like fun and akin to authentic experiences.
